Headliner: Dauood Naimyar
Dauood Mohammad Naimyar is an Afghan American comedian making waves in the comedy world. He’s performed at top venues like the Punchline, Cobb’s Comedy Club, and San Jose Improv, with appearances on Don’t Tell Comedy and Comedy Central. Beyond the stage, his sharp, culturally insightful humor has earned him over 250,000 followers on TikTok and Instagram. Dauood’s comedy draws from his experiences as an Afghan living in America, with viral hits satirizing politicians and world leaders. Catch him now in Chinatown before he’s selling out stadiums!
